Tushar Kawale, the talented actor who is going great guns with his negative portrayal in Colors’ Shakti – Astitva Ke Ehsaas Ki, in the role of Chintu feels that the show has given him a great learning curve.

Says Tushar, “This is the first time I played a full-fledged negative character in my career. I enjoyed the whole ride. I received huge support from the entire team. I used to watch Shakti a long time back. I got a really good response for my portrayal.”

Tushar, who has mostly tried his hand at comedy till now, feels that “I am comfortable in every kind of role and emotion. I am a theatre actor. It has almost been 10 years now, with me being in theatre. I see myself capable of performing any kind of given emotion.”

Tushar who is socially very active makes a lot of reels on social media that garner quite a lot of traction. “I make reels which are comic. People like to be relieved of their stress when they watch reels.”

Tushar has been part of a Marathi web series, on which the post-production work is on. He has also been part of the Marathi film with Rinku Rajguru, titled Aathava Rang Premacha.

He says, “I will not mind doing any kind of role, provided there is meat in it.”
